Technological Breakthroughs
Advancements in technology are at the heart of renewable energy's future. Solar panels and wind turbines are becoming more efficient, affordable, and adaptable. For instance, solar energy technologies now include thin-film solar cells that can be integrated into building materials, opening up new possibilities for urban energy generation.
Energy Storage Solutions
One of the biggest challenges for renewable energy has been storage. However, recent developments in battery technology, such as solid-state batteries, are set to revolutionize how we store and use renewable energy. These advancements ensure a steady energy supply, even when the sun isn't shining or the wind isn't blowing.

The Role of AI and IoT
Artificial Intelligence (AI) and the Internet of Things (IoT) are playing pivotal roles in optimizing renewable energy systems. From predicting energy demand to maintaining equipment, these technologies are making renewable energy more reliable and efficient.

Community and Decentralized Energy
The future of renewable energy is not just about large-scale projects. Community and decentralized energy systems are gaining traction, allowing individuals and communities to generate their own power and even sell excess back to the grid.
